Wedding gift that doesn't give
by frostygirl ,May 25 '08
Pros: Looks nice. Pizza fit design is great idea. Cons: Doesn't cook evenly. Heating capabilities cumbersome
I registered for it- so I can't complain. I chose this model simply on looks alone. It's got a large window, lightweight, and I liked the interior build (they created a half moon extension inside to fit a pizza). Unfortunately this model leave me longing. Longing for toast in under 10 minutes, evenly cooked food, and silence as I sip my morning coffee waaaaiiiiiting for my 10 minute toast. There are (3) dials. One is a timer with option of light medium & dark. The other dial is Bake, Broil, or Slow Bake. The third is temperature in degree ranges, similar to an oven. The beauty of a toaster oven is not having to use the real oven. Intuitively- there should be a built in heat for light medium & dark & it should apply to the WHOLE of what you are cooking. I am constantly getting things burnt in the back. Next time I will take a loaf of bread with me into the store for realistic testing.

Waste of time, money and space
by lesstuff ,Sep 14 '07
Pros: Fine looking. All metal (no plastic). Cons: Piece of junk.
Lovely to look at--maybe should be sold as a doorstop? Knob mechanisms are imprecise and after a month of use one snapped apart. Makes terrible toast, burning some spots and leaving others raw. Purchased to use as an alternative to our larger oven for heating small dishes and for toasting, a hybrid function or dearly departed toaster oven seemed to handle fine (you always sacrifice a level of toastiness when you use a toaster oven vs. a toaster, but counter real estate is limited). Would not buy again.
